## Snapshaven Environments

Welcome aboard! Snapshaven runs three environments: dev, staging, and prod. Heads up: the image cache in staging has a known memory leak, so the cache worker gets restarted every six hours by a cron job — don't panic when you see it in the logs. Prod has a patched build with tighter eviction. Staging currently runs with the configuration shown below.

settings of tagef-bawif:
DRUIX_HOST=druix.zemvarlabs.internal
DRUIX_PORT=8000

Markdown pipeline runbook — Ferngate renderer. If preview output is blank, check the Slateroot sanitizer stage first; it silently drops documents over 2MB. Restart the worker pool, then replay the failed queue from the Mirrowell dashboard. Do not clear the cache unless rendering errors persist after replay. Escalate to the Ferngate on-call if replay loops twice. Verification requires the trace token from the last successful replay, shown below.

trace token, yahif-kagep: htk31_bd0cc6b1d7ab4f7094c586a5de900e0

Loading dock orientation: the dock at Verelan Point accepts deliveries between 07:00 and 16:30 on weekdays only. Anything arriving outside those hours must be rescheduled — the dock shutter is alarmed overnight. If you're expecting a personal or team delivery, book a slot with facilities the day before. New starters collecting a delivery should enter via the dock side door, which requires the pass code below.

turnstile pass: bdg-FVNQRS-72965873

## Configuration

Report exports in Tendrel default to UTC. Set REPORT_TZ to an IANA zone to localize timestamps in CSV and PDF output. Scheduled exports resolve the zone at render time, not enqueue time, so DST shifts are handled correctly. Do not set TZ on the container; the exporter ignores it. Recurring schedules store cron expressions in the configured zone. The exporter also signs download links, and the signing credential is set on the following line of the env file.

secret setting of yagef-baweg: RELAY_SECRET29=cb53deb59a49ed54d9f43599b54ca